Lithium-Ion Batteries

One of the most significant advancements in battery technology has been developing and using lithium-ion batteries. Lithium-ion batteries have several advantages over traditional lead-acid batteries, including significantly lighter weight and longer lifespan. Additionally, they are much more efficient at delivering power to your vehicle’s systems, which translates to better fuel economy and overall performance.

Battery Swaps

Another innovation that’s gaining traction is the concept of battery swapping. Instead of waiting for your vehicle’s battery to charge, you can quickly swap it out for a fully charged one. Companies like Tesla are already offering battery swap services for their electric vehicles. The process generally takes just a few minutes, making it a convenient option for those on the go.

Wireless Charging

While many of us are used to plugging our cell phones in at night to charge, imagine doing the same for your car. Wireless charging is currently in development and could offer a significant breakthrough in the world of electric vehicles. The idea is to use magnetic fields to transfer energy between a charging pad on the ground and your vehicle’s battery. Just park your car over the pad, and it starts charging automatically.

Fast Charging Stations

As electric vehicles become more popular, quick charging stations are also popping up around the country. These stations allow you to charge your vehicle’s battery up to 80% in as little as 30 minutes. While still in the early stages, developing these fast charging stations could spur even more people to switch to electric vehicles.

Battery Recycling

As battery technology continues to develop, the need for responsible recycling and disposal of old batteries is growing. Some companies are even exploring reusing old batteries in new vehicles, reducing waste and lowering the overall cost of battery production. Additionally, recycling efforts can prevent harmful materials from ending up in landfills and polluting the environment.
